Peach Cobbler Recipe

Ingredients:

1 (15 oz) can of peaches
1 cup flour (self-rising or plain)
1 cup sugar
1/2 stick butter
2 tsp. baking powder
2 cups milk

Directions:

Melt butter in baking dish; add peaches. In a separate bowl, mix flour, sugar, baking powder, and milk into a batter. Pour over peach-butter mixture. Do not stir. Bake at 325º for 1 hour or until golden brown.

Number Of Servings:

6 servings
Preparation Time:

10 minutes
